Nigeria's record appearance holder in Serie A tells Man Utd, Spurs what to expect if they sign Belotti
Published: June 15, 2021Christian Obodo, Nigeria's record appearance holder in the Italian Serie
A with 196 games under his belt for four different clubs Perugia,
Udinese, Fiorentina and US Lecce, is convinced that Italy international Andrea Belotti will cut it in the English Premier League.
Torino president Urbano Cairo is willing to listen to offers for Belotti this summer with the striker's contract set to expire on June 30, 2022.
Manchester United have been linked with a move for the 27-year-old on numerous occasions while Tottenham Hotspur and West Ham United are also among his suitors in England.
Obodo thinks this is the appropriate time for Andrea Belotti to end his six-year association with Torino and highlighted that one of the Premier League clubs interested in his services would be signing a workaholic player if the move goes through.
"Belotti has tried a lot, he has really made Torino proud, has been carrying Torino these past years," Obodo told allnigeriasoccer.com.
"A lot of clubs have been looking to sign him but at the end of the season he always remained at Torino.
"I think it is high-time for him to move if he has those offers from the likes of Manchester United and Tottenham Hotspur because he is a player that doesn't give up.
"Belotti fights for the team, he works for the team, he can play, he can do everything as far as the ball is concerned, so if he goes to England it will not be difficult for him because he is not a lazy player.
"He is a workaholic player, you know sometimes the management don't give players the whole time to adapt to the new environment but I believe Belotti has really, really proved himself.
"He has played in the Europa League qualifiers, for Italy's national team, he is not going to find it difficult anywhere he goes".
